Observations:
Vitiligo and psoriasis are both common dermatoses. There have been several reports of the concurrence of these diseases associated with other autoimmune states. Herein, we report a 66-year-old female patient presented with acrofacial vitiligo, palmoplantar psoriasis and autoimmune hypothyroidism.
